Auburn Tigers beat Oklahoma 98-70

The Auburn Tigers men's basketball team dominated in a blowout 98-70 win over Oklahoma on Tuesday, February 5, 2025, at Neville Arena. This win kept the Tigers undefeated in Southeastern Conference play.

Auburn's coach Bruce Pearl acknowledged that Oklahoma is "really, really good offensively" but also noted that his team had some advantages that they were able to capitalize on. The Tigers' strong defensive play and ability to take advantage of second-chance opportunities were key factors in their victory. They held the Sooners to a season-low 33.3% shooting from the floor and forced 15 turnovers, which resulted in 22 points for the Tigers.

The Tigers' bigs were crucial in the win, with Johni Broome leading the way. Broome had an impressive all-around performance, finishing with 15 points, five rebounds, six assists, three blocked shots, and three steals. He was well supported by Dylan Cardwell, who added eight points, three rebounds, and a career-high six blocked shots. Chaney Johnson also came off the bench to contribute 13 points and a team-high eight rebounds.

Auburn's ability to control the boards in the second half was another important factor in their success. Despite only holding a slim 18-17 rebounding advantage in the first half, the Tigers dominated in the second half, out-rebounding the Sooners 20-11. This helped them secure the win, as they were able to limit Oklahoma's second-chance opportunities and convert on their own extra possessions.

Win over Vanderbilt: 80-68

On February 11, 2025, Auburn won their basketball game against Vanderbilt with a final score of 80-68. This win prevented the Tigers from facing their first losing streak of the season.

Auburn's Denver Jones scored 21 points, with Chaney Johnson finishing with 20 points and Johni Broome adding 17. Vanderbilt's Chris Manon dunked the ball over Broome and Johnson during the first half of the game.

Auburn coach Bruce Pearl said, "There was not going to be one ounce of looking past Vanderbilt to Saturday. We haven’t talked about the game at all -- we will be starting this week -- because we respected Vanderbilt."

Following the win, Auburn's record for the season stood at 22-2, with a 10-1 record in SEC play. The Tigers then prepared for their biggest game of the year, facing off against No. 2 Alabama.

Beat Texas 87-82

On January 7, 2025, Auburn beat Texas 87-82 in a game that gave coach Bruce Pearl his record-breaking 214th win at Auburn. This win made him the winningest coach in Auburn basketball history.

The Auburn Tigers' top-rated offense was in full flow, and their defense made life difficult for the talented scorer-heavy Texas Longhorns roster. Texas, however, was determined not to lose its first two games in the SEC, and the game became a one-possession game in the final minutes. The Tigers made the clutch shots late to win, showing their "togetherness and ability to overcome adversity," as Johni Broome, who had 20 points and 12 rebounds, later commented.

This win was Auburn's first on the road in what is shaping up to be a historically brutal SEC schedule. Coach Pearl commented after the game: "We needed a close game and to have to step up… and do the things we had to do [...] Wins could be precious and few. Every win in this league is going to be one that you earn."
